Detailed Description

Theora encoder using libtheora.

Author
Paul Richards paul..nosp@m.rich.nosp@m.ards@.nosp@m.gmai.nosp@m.l.com

A lot of this is copy / paste from other output codecs in libavcodec or pure guesswork (or both).

I have used t_ prefixes on variables which are libtheora types and o_ prefixes on variables which are libogg types.

Definition in file libtheoraenc.c.
